What we look for:

We are seeking a highly motivated and technically skilled individual to join our UK&I Enterprise Manufacturing, Defence and Automotive which focuses on supporting and growing customers in the UK&I. This role offers the opportunity to be based in the London Office, with regular collaboration across the UK&I region and close alignment with our London‑based team.

Core Technical Qualifications:

  • Hands‑on experience in technical pre‑sales or consultancy, with a strong background in Data Science – traditional Machine Learning, Deep Learning, Artificial Intelligence or Generative AI.
  • Demonstrated ability to architect end‑to‑end Data & AI solutions, with specific expertise in modern Generative AI concepts (e.g., fine‑tuning, RAG, MLOps for LLMs), using either open source and/or ISV tools such as Dataiku, Domino, DataRobot etc.
  • Strong proficiency in a core programming language (e.g., Python, SQL) and a willingness to learn (or existing knowledge of) Spark.
  • Proficiency with big data analytics technologies and public c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, or GCP).
  • Hands‑on expertise in designing and delivering complex proofs‑of‑concept (PoCs).

Pre‑Sales & Customer‑Facing Skills:

  • Proven ability to engage with customers in a technical sales capacity: challenging assumptions, guiding discussions to clear outcomes, and communicating both technical and business value propositions.
  • Experience in the full pre‑sales lifecycle, including use case discovery, solution scoping, and delivering complex solution architecture designs to diverse audiences (from engineers to executives).
  • A customer‑centric mindset with a passion for building client relationships and internal partnerships with account teams.

Seniority & Leadership:

  • Demonstrated experience in coaching and mentoring junior team members to help them develop their technical and customer‑facing skills.

Logistics:

  • Ability to commute to the London office regularly.
  • Willingness and ability to travel approximately 20‑30% of the time across UK&I and EMEA for customer visits.

Nice to Have:

  • The company or other relevant Cloud/Data certifications.
  • Experience working within the Manufacturing, Defence or Automotive sectors.
